How should a Kent firm decide whether to build or buy?+
Buy when an existing product genuinely matches the workflow. Consider custom software when your firm is paying for unused functionality or maintaining manual work between systems. Compare the documented bottleneck, data requirements, permissions, integration needs and acceptance criteria rather than choosing based on location alone.
Will custom software guarantee better search visibility or more clients?+
No such conclusion follows from choosing custom software. Software can address an operational workflow, but it does not establish demand, rankings, leads, cases or revenue. If the project touches website content, evaluate accuracy, relevance and original value separately; automation itself does not guarantee crawling, indexing or visibility.
